在数字化转型的浪潮中,企业对数据的依赖程度日益增加。数据作为企业的核心资产,其安全性和可用性变得至关重要。然而,自然灾害、硬件故障、网络攻击等不可预见的因素可能随时导致数据丢失或系统瘫痪。为了应对这些风险,灾备系统应运而生。基于云计算的灾备系统以其高可用性、灵活性和成本效益,成为企业构建灾备能力的首选方案。
本文将深入探讨基于云计算的灾备系统架构设计与实现,为企业提供实用的指导和建议。
一、什么是云灾备?
云灾备(Cloud Disaster Recovery)是指利用云计算技术,将企业的核心业务系统、数据和资源备份到云平台上,以确保在发生灾难性事件时,能够快速恢复业务,保障系统的可用性和数据的完整性。
与传统的灾备方案相比,云灾备具有以下优势:
- 高可用性:云平台通过多副本、多区域的部署方式,确保数据的高冗余和高可靠性。
- 弹性扩展:根据业务需求,动态调整资源规模,避免传统灾备系统资源浪费的问题。
- 成本效益:无需投入大量硬件和运维人员,按需付费的模式降低了企业的初期投入。
- 快速部署:云灾备系统可以在短时间内完成部署,缩短业务中断的时间。
二、云灾备系统的架构设计
基于云计算的灾备系统架构设计需要综合考虑数据备份、存储、网络、安全等多个方面。以下是典型的云灾备系统架构设计要点:
1. 数据备份与存储
- 数据备份:采用定时备份、增量备份和全量备份相结合的方式,确保数据的完整性和一致性。
- 存储方案:使用云存储服务(如阿里云OSS、腾讯云COS)进行数据存储,支持高可用性和高扩展性。
- 数据冗余:通过多副本机制(如阿里云的三副本、腾讯云的多AZ部署),确保数据在物理节点上的冗余存储。
2. 网络架构
- 混合部署:企业可以在本地数据中心和云平台之间实现混合部署,通过专线或VPN确保数据传输的安全性和稳定性。
- 负载均衡:在云平台上部署负载均衡器,确保业务流量的均衡分配,提升系统的抗压能力。
3. 监控与告警
- 实时监控:通过云监控服务(如阿里云云监控、腾讯云监控),实时监控系统的运行状态和资源使用情况。
- 告警机制:设置阈值告警,当系统出现异常时,及时通知运维人员进行处理。
4. 灾难恢复
- 自动切换:在发生灾难性事件时,系统能够自动切换到备用节点,确保业务的连续性。
- 快速恢复:通过预配置的恢复策略,快速重建业务系统,减少业务中断时间。
三、云灾备系统的实现步骤
基于云计算的灾备系统实现需要遵循以下步骤:
1. 需求分析
- 业务影响分析(BIA):评估不同业务场景在灾难发生时的恢复需求,确定关键业务系统的恢复时间目标(RTO)和恢复点目标(RPO)。
- 资源评估:根据业务需求,评估所需的计算、存储和网络资源。
2. 架构设计
- 选择云平台:根据企业的实际需求,选择合适的云服务提供商(如阿里云、腾讯云、AWS等)。
- 设计备份策略:制定数据备份的频率、方式和存储位置。
- 网络规划:设计混合部署的网络架构,确保数据传输的安全性和稳定性。
3. 系统部署
- 数据迁移:将本地数据迁移到云平台,确保数据的完整性和一致性。
- 系统测试:在云平台上部署测试环境,验证灾备系统的可用性和可靠性。
4. 监控与优化
- 持续监控:通过监控工具实时监控系统的运行状态,及时发现和解决问题。
- 定期优化:根据业务需求的变化,优化灾备系统的架构和资源分配。
四、云灾备系统的应用场景
基于云计算的灾备系统适用于多种场景,以下是几个典型的应用场景:
1. 金融行业
- 高可用性要求:金融行业对系统的可用性和数据的完整性要求极高,云灾备系统能够满足其严格的业务连续性要求。
- 快速恢复:在发生故障时,能够快速恢复业务,减少客户流失和经济损失。
2. 电子商务
- 高并发访问:电子商务平台需要应对高并发访问的压力,云灾备系统能够通过弹性扩展确保系统的稳定性。
- 数据安全:通过云存储和备份服务,保障交易数据的安全性和可靠性。
3. 政府与公共事业
- 数据安全性:政府和公共事业部门需要处理大量的敏感数据,云灾备系统能够提供高安全性的数据存储和备份服务。
- 应急响应:在突发事件中,能够快速恢复业务系统,保障社会运行的稳定性。
五、云灾备系统的挑战与解决方案
尽管云灾备系统具有诸多优势,但在实际应用中仍面临一些挑战:
1. 数据一致性
- 挑战:在多副本和多区域部署中,如何保证数据的一致性是一个难题。
- 解决方案:通过分布式一致性算法(如Paxos、Raft)和强一致性存储服务(如阿里云的Table Store),确保数据的强一致性。
2. 网络延迟
- 挑战:混合部署模式下,本地数据中心和云平台之间的网络延迟可能影响系统的性能。
- 解决方案:通过专线或优化网络架构,降低网络延迟,提升系统的响应速度。
3. 成本控制
- 挑战:云灾备系统的建设和运维成本较高,如何在成本和性能之间找到平衡点是一个难点。
- 解决方案:通过按需付费的模式和资源优化配置,降低企业的总体成本。
六、未来趋势与建议
随着云计算技术的不断发展,云灾备系统将朝着以下几个方向演进:
- 智能化:通过人工智能和机器学习技术,实现灾备系统的智能监控和自动恢复。
- 边缘计算:结合边缘计算技术,实现数据的就近存储和备份,降低传输延迟。
- 多云部署:通过多云策略,避免对单一云平台的依赖,提升系统的抗风险能力。
对于企业而言,选择合适的云灾备方案需要综合考虑业务需求、技术能力和预算规模。建议企业在实施云灾备系统之前,进行全面的需求分析和风险评估,确保系统的可靠性和可用性。
七、申请试用,体验云灾备的强大功能
如果您对基于云计算的灾备系统感兴趣,不妨申请试用相关服务,亲身体验其强大的功能和优势。通过实际操作,您可以更好地理解云灾备的实现原理和应用场景,为企业的数字化转型提供有力支持。
申请试用
申请试用
申请试用
通过本文的介绍,您应该对基于云计算的灾备系统有了更深入的了解。无论是从架构设计、实现步骤,还是应用场景和未来趋势,云灾备系统都为企业提供了强有力的支持。希望本文能够为您提供有价值的参考,帮助您更好地构建和优化企业的灾备能力。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。